Last time, I hacked to add one extra > config file including all changed entries. But forget it now:( Luckily it isn't all that tricky anymore. If you create any file with ".cfg" as the extension that contains a series of kernel configuration values and add it to the SRC_URI in the same manner as any patch/defconfig, you've done most of the work to modifying the kernel configuration. The contents of that .cfg file will be added to the end of the kernel configuration and applied to the kernel build. Those changes can then be sent for merging into the kernel repository as default values for the BSP in question. > > What's your suggestion for our kernel user to hack the config? See above. Start with a .cfg file, and then when you are happy with the configuration changes, you can either modify the 'meta' branch directly or simply send the .cfg file to me in a pull request and I'll apply it to the meta branch and merge it into the repository as the default for the BSP in question.'
